CVE-2025-23050
The CVE-2025-23050 affects QLowEnergyController in Qt before 6.8.2. It arises from mishandling malformed Bluetooth ATT commands, causing an out-of-bounds read or a division-by-zero error. Patches are available in Qt 5.15.19, Qt 6.5.9, and Qt 6.8.2. This has been observed in multiple vulnerability...

SUSE CVE-2018-16056
In Wireshark 2.6.0 to 2.6.2, 2.4.0 to 2.4.8, and 2.2.0 to 2.2.16, the Bluetooth Attribute Protocol dissector could crash. This was addressed in epan/dissectors/packet-btatt.c by verifying that a dissector for a specific UUID exists...

CVE-2019-19192
The Bluetooth Low Energy implementation on STMicroelectronics BLE Stack through 1.3.1 for STM32WB5x devices does not properly handle consecutive Attribute Protocol ATT requests on reception, allowing attackers in radio range to cause an event deadlock or crash via crafted packets...
